Title: Sexual Abuse of Minors

Highlights:
-Defines sexual abuse of a minor in the first, second, third, and fourth degree [Sec 1 (6-2-314—317)]. -Provides punishments as imprisonment for 5 to 50 years depending on degree of offense [Sec 1 (62-314—317)]. -Specifies that adults soliciting minors under the age of 14 are guilty of a felony punishable by a sentence of up to five years [Sec 1 (62-318)]. -Requires the court to protect the minor victim and restricts the release their name unless the name has been publicly disclosed to find the victim by the parent/legal guardian of the minor or by a law enforcement agency [Sec 1 (62-319)].
